    one of the most advanced Open Source games is IMHO FreeCiv. Some years ago Sebastian Bauer has done a very good port to AmigaOS with a GUI based on MUI. Later itix has improved it and ported it to MorphOS.
    Since then FreeCiv has improved a lot.

    I wonder if there's a capable programmer out there willing to update the MorphOS port based on latest FreeCiv sources ?
    Even though a MUI version would be my favourite, there's also the probably easier to achive possibility to base a MorphOS port on the now also available SDL based Client.

    The main problem with the current MorphOS Client is, that most servers require more up2date Client versions.

    Btw I tried to resurrect MUI client many years ago when 2.0 was still new. It is hopeless. You would have to maintain MUI GUI weekly to keep it up to date due to many changes and fixes introduced almost daily. It was difficult with 1.x and with 2.x GUI had to be rewritten from scratch.

    Besides I think system standard GUI is not aesthetically fitting to games like this...

    I like the programming part, so it's the same deal for me. I just can't playtest it much, beyond moving some units around. Anyway, I identified the problem, the server indeed got stuck on FGets when it was not launched from the shell. Adding a WaitForChar before it seems to have solved the problem. A new version uploaded.
